A visual representation of where all the prospects are in the purchasing process is called the?

Answers

A visual representation of where all the prospects are in the purchasing process is called the sales funnel. A sales funnel is a marketing concept that illustrates the customer journey from initial awareness to the final purchase. It represents the different stages that a prospect goes through before becoming a customer.

The sales funnel typically consists of four main stages:

1. Awareness: This is the stage where prospects become aware of your product or service. They may come across your brand through various marketing channels such as social media, search engines, or advertisements.

2. Interest: Once prospects are aware of your offering, they may show interest by exploring more about it. They might visit your website, read customer reviews, or engage with your content.

3. Decision: At this stage, prospects evaluate your product or service and compare it with alternatives. They consider factors like price, features, and benefits to make a decision.

4. Action: The final stage of the sales funnel is when prospects convert into customers by making a purchase.

By visualizing the sales funnel, businesses can understand the conversion rates at each stage and identify areas for improvement. It helps in optimizing marketing strategies and sales efforts to effectively move prospects through the purchasing process.

The difference between the maximum price a consumer is willing to pay for a product and the actual price that they do pay is known as _____.

Answers

The difference between the maximum price a consumer is willing to pay for a product and the actual price that they do pay is known as Consumer surplus.

Consumer surplus is the difference between the maximum price a consumer is willing to pay for a product and the actual price they pay. It represents the economic benefit or value that consumers receive from purchasing a product at a price lower than what they were willing to pay.

To calculate consumer surplus, you need to know the consumer's willingness to pay (WTP) and the actual price they pay (P). The formula for consumer surplus is:

Consumer Surplus = WTP - P

For example, let's say a consumer is willing to pay $50 for a product, but they purchase it for $30. The consumer surplus would be:

Consumer Surplus = $50 - $30 = $20

In this case, the consumer surplus is $20, which represents the additional value the consumer gained from purchasing the product at a price lower than their maximum willingness to pay.

The difference between the maximum price a consumer is willing to pay for a product and the actual price they pay is known as consumer surplus. It quantifies the economic benefit or value that consumers receive when they can purchase a product at a price lower than their maximum willingness to pay.

A basic assumption of accounting that requires activities of an entity be kept separate from the activities of its owner is referred to as the a. stand-alone concept. b. monetary unit assumption. c. corporate form of ownership. d. separate entity assumption.

Answers

d). separate entity assumption. The separate entity assumption is a basic assumption of accounting that requires the activities of an entity to be kept separate from the activities of its owner. This means that a business is considered as a separate entity from its owner(s), and its financial transactions and records should be maintained independently.


For example, let's say you own a small business. According to the separate entity assumption, you need to keep your personal transactions separate from your business transactions. This means that you should have separate bank accounts, financial statements, and records for your personal finances and your business finances. By doing so, you can accurately determine the financial health and performance of your business without any confusion or mixing of personal and business activities.


In summary, the separate entity assumption in accounting requires the activities of an entity to be kept separate from the activities of its owner. This helps maintain the integrity and reliability of financial information, allowing for accurate analysis and evaluation of a business's financial performance.

The total dollar return on a stock is the sum of the______ and the______.

a. interest payments; dividends

b. dividends; capital gains

c. capital gains; interest payments

Answers

The right option is b. dividends, capital gains. The sum of dividends and capital gains is the stock's overall dollar return.

The total dollar return on a stock represents the overall financial gain or loss an investor experiences from owning that stock over a specific period. It is calculated by considering both dividends and capital gains.

Dividends refer to the periodic payments made by a company to its shareholders as a distribution of profits. Usually, they receive payment in the form of cash or more stock. Dividends are a form of income for stockholders and contribute to the total return on the investment.

Capital gains, on the other hand, arise when the value of the stock increases between the time of purchase and the time of sale. If an investor sells a stock for a higher price than the purchase price, they realize a capital gain. Capital gains are determined by the difference between the selling price and the purchase price.

To calculate the total dollar return, one would sum the dividends received during the holding period and the capital gains realized upon selling the stock.

The sum of dividends and capital gains is the stock's overall dollar return. Dividends represent the periodic income received by stockholders, while capital gains arise from the increase in the stock's value between the time of purchase and sale. Considering both dividends and capital gains provides a comprehensive view of the total financial return on an investment in a stock.
